This unit

The Anritsu 69077A Synthesized CW Generator delivers precise, stable continuous-wave signals across 0.01 to 50 GHz. Engineered for telecommunications, radar, and defense test environments, this instrument combines low single-sideband phase noise, minimal spurious content, and controlled output power to serve as a local oscillator replacement and general-purpose RF/microwave signal source.


Technical Specifications

Frequency Range: 0.01 to 50 GHz with 1 kHz resolution (0.1 Hz with Option 11) Output Power:

  • +12 dBm (0.01 to <2 GHz)

  • +10 dBm (2 to 20 to ≤40 GHz)

  • Guaranteed leveled power up to +10 dBm (maximum +17 dBm leveled)

  • Minimum leveled output: −15 dBm (−120 dBm with attenuator, −140 dBm with electronic attenuator)

  • Power resolution: 0.01 dB logarithmic or 0.001 mV linear Frequency Stability:

  • Internal time base: <2 × 10⁻⁸/day aging (<5 × 10⁻¹⁰/day with Option 16)

  • Temperature stability: <2 × 10⁻⁸/°C over 0 to 55°C (<2 × 10⁻¹⁰/°C with Option 16) Phase Noise: Low SSB phase noise; typical −107 dBc/Hz at 10 kHz offset (10 GHz carrier) Spurious Performance: Harmonic and harmonic-related spurious <−50 dBc (500 MHz to 2.2 GHz); 50 MHz to 2 GHz)


Key Features



  • Twenty independent presettable CW frequencies (F0–F9, M0–M9)

  • External 10 MHz reference input and 0.5 V p-p output (50 Ω, AC coupled)

  • Optional step sweep with 1 MHz to full-range width, 1 to 10,000 steps, variable 1 ms to 99 seconds dwell

  • Fast frequency switching: <40 ms to 1 kHz settling; <5 ms for <100 MHz steps


Typical Applications Local oscillator replacement, receiver/transmitter testing, component characterization, and system-level RF validation in defense and commercial telecommunications.


Compatibility & Integration Part of the Anritsu 69000A Series. Accepts internal or external 10 MHz time base with optional high-stability oscillator upgrade (Option 16).

Common Anritsu 69077A faults: YIG oscillator failure (no output or loss of lock), step attenuator wear (output drops or steps at set attenuation), ALC loop failure (uncontrolled output power), I/Q modulator assembly failure.
